Understanding ADHD

Before diving into the search for a psychiatrist, it's important to have a clear understanding of ADHD. ADHD is a chronic condition that can begin in childhood and continue into adulthood. It is typically identified in children, but lots of adults who were not diagnosed during their childhood may likewise look for assistance later on in life. The 3 main kinds of ADHD are:

  1. Inattentive Type: Individuals have problem organizing tasks, focusing on details, and often appear forgetful or quickly sidetracked.
  2. Hyperactive-Impulsive Type: Individuals exhibit extreme movement, fidgeting, and find it difficult to sit still. They may likewise act impulsively without considering the repercussions.
  3. Combined Type: Individuals show a combination of neglectful and hyperactive-impulsive signs.

The Role of an ADHD Psychiatrist

An ADHD psychiatrist is a medical doctor who concentrates on mental health and is trained to identify and treat ADHD. They can provide an extensive examination, prescribe medication, and offer restorative interventions to help manage signs. Unlike family doctors, psychiatrists have substantial training in psychiatric disorders and can tailor treatment strategies to individual requirements.

FAQs About ADHD Psychiatry

Q: How do I understand if I need to see an ADHD psychiatrist?

  • A: If you suspect you or a loved one has ADHD and are experiencing significant difficulties in every day life, such as problem focusing, impulsivity, or hyperactivity, it's a good concept to see a psychiatrist. They can provide an expert diagnosis and customize a treatment strategy to your specific needs.

Q: What should I expect during the first appointment?

  • A: The first appointment usually includes a comprehensive discussion of your signs, case history, and household history. The psychiatrist might likewise utilize standardized assessments to help detect ADHD. You should expect an extensive and thorough evaluation.

Q: Are there different types of medication for ADHD?

  • A: Yes, there are numerous kinds of medication utilized to treat ADHD, consisting of stimulants (like Ritalin and Adderall) and non-stimulants (like Strattera). The choice of medication depends upon the person's symptoms and case history.

Q: Can therapy assist with ADHD?

  • A: Absolutely.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), behavior modification, and other forms of therapy can be highly effective in managing ADHD signs. Therapy can help individuals establish coping strategies, improve organizational skills, and attend to any co-occurring conditions.

Q: How long does treatment for ADHD generally last?

  • A: Treatment for ADHD is normally long-lasting. Numerous people continue to see a psychiatrist for ongoing management of their signs. The particular period and frequency of consultations will differ based on the person's reaction to treatment and general progress.

Q: What if the treatment isn't working?

  • A: If you're not seeing the wanted outcomes, it's important to interact this with your psychiatrist. They may adjust the medication, change the dosage, or check out other treatment alternatives, such as therapy or lifestyle modifications.
